MEMMOVE(3)		   Linux Programmer's Manual		    MEMMOVE(3)

NAME
       memmove - copy memory area

SYNOPSIS
       #include <string.h>

       void *memmove(void *dest, const void *src, size_t n);

DESCRIPTION
       The  memmove()  function	 copies n bytes from memory area src to memory
       area dest.  The memory areas may overlap: copying takes place as though
       the  bytes in src are first copied into a temporary array that does not
       overlap src or dest, and the bytes are then copied from	the  temporary
       array to dest.

RETURN VALUE
       The memmove() function returns a pointer to dest.

ATTRIBUTES
       For   an	  explanation	of   the  terms	 used  in  this	 section,  see
       attributes(7).

       ┌──────────┬───────────────┬─────────┐
       │Interface │ Attribute	  │ Value   │
       ├──────────┼───────────────┼─────────┤
       │memmove() │ Thread safety │ MT-Safe │
       └──────────┴───────────────┴─────────┘
CONFORMING TO
       POSIX.1-2001, POSIX.1-2008, C89, C99, SVr4, 4.3BSD.
